French Onion Beef Sloppy Joes

Savory French Onion Beef Sloppy Joes for Comfort Food Bliss

Indulge in French Onion Beef Sloppy Joes, a gourmet twist on the classic comfort food, featuring savory beef and caramelized onions.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 20 minutes
Total Time 30 minutes
Servings: 4 sandwiches
Course: Beef
Cuisine: American
Calories: 450

Ingredients
  

For the Filling
  • 1 pound Ground Beef Opt for lean varieties for lower fat choice.
  • 2 large Onions Thinly sliced; can substitute with shallots for a milder flavor.
  • 2 tablespoons Soy Sauce Use coconut aminos for a gluten-free alternative.
  • 1 teaspoon Garlic Powder Adjust to taste.
  • 1 teaspoon Onion Powder Adjust to taste.
For the Topping
  • 1 cup Shredded Cheese Mozzarella or Swiss works best for that authentic gourmet touch.
For Serving
  • 4 gluten-free Buns These hold all the delicious filling.
  • Fresh Herbs (optional) Chopped parsley or chives can brighten the dish.

Equipment

  • large skillet
  • spatula
  • lid

Method
 

Step-by-Step Instructions
  1. Slice the onions thinly and he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Add onions and cook, stirring frequently until caramelized, about 10-15 minutes.
  2. Push the onions to the side and add ground beef. Cook, breaking apart, until browned, about 5-7 minutes.
  3. Stir in soy sauce, garlic powder, and onion powder. Mix well and cook for an additional 2 minutes.
  4. Sprinkle cheese over the beef mixture and cover. Allow cheese to melt on low heat for 2-3 minutes.
  5. Toast gluten-free buns until golden, then spoon beef and cheese mixture onto each bun.
  6. Serve immediately, optionally garnished with fresh herbs.
